Box Score 2 Grand Rapids, Mich. - The Alma College baseball team got its bats going and played solid defense in the series opener at Cavin College, sweeping the Knights in both games of a doubleheader on Friday (April 22). With the pair of wins, the Scots improved to 19-10 overall and 10-8 in the MIAA.
Alma is now one win away from becoming the third team in school history to record 20 wins, and sits four wins shy of the school-record of 23 wins, set by the 1981 squad.
The Scots will host the Knights in the series finale on Monday, April 26, with the first pitch scheduled for 2:00 p.m. at Klenk Park on the campus of Alma College.
Game 1 - Alma 2, at Calvin 1 (8 innings)
Dayne San Miguel (Wheeler, Mich./Breckenridge/Kellogg CC) hit an RBI single with two outs in the top of the eighth inning to score Adam Thoryk (Syracuse, N.Y./John C. Birdlebough/St. John Fisher) and give the Scots a 2-1 victory over host Calvin College.
The win also snapped a five-game losing streak for Alma, which had dropped seven of its last eight games entering the Calvin series.
Junior Alex Valasek (Saginaw, Mich./Nouvel Catholic Central) went wire-to-wire on the mound, holding the Knights to just three hits and recording eight strikeouts for the second straight game.
Calvin got on the board first in the bottom of the second thanks to an RBI double by Nate DeZwann before the Scots tied the game in the top of the sixth inning. Senior Doug Walters (Brighton, Mich./Brighton) hit a single to left-center field, and an error by the outfielder allowed junior Greg Goffee (Dexter, Mich./Dexter) to score from second base.
In the final inning, a hit by senior Yoan De La Rosa (Bronx, N.Y./Morris/Monroe College) put runners on first and third base, then the bases were loaded after junior Patrick Finn (Allenton, Mich./Almont) was walked, setting up San Miguel's at-bat. De La Rosa finished the game 3-for-4, tying a career-high for hits in a game.
Game 2 - Alma 8, at Calvin 0 (7 innings)
Junior Alex Peczynski (Farmington Hills, Mich./Detroit Catholic Central) went 3-for-4 as the Scots poured on the offense, shutting out Calvin with an 8-0 victory. Senior Matt Launstein (Flushing, Mich./Flushing) pitched the entire game and snapped a two-game losing streak. He also struck out four batters while keeping Calvin to six hits.
Four other Alma players recorded multiple hits in the game as the Scots registered 13 hits against the Knights' pitching staff.
Alma scored first, tallying three runs in the top of the third inning. San Miguel started the inning off with a single and advanced to second on a wild pitch, then scored on the next at bat when Peczynski singled to right-center field. Finn walked in the next-at bat, then sophomore Austin Roeske (Warren, Mich./De La Salle Collegiate) put down a sacrifice bunt to advance both Peczynski and Finn into scoring position. Sophomore Matthew Minaudo (Clinton Township, Mich./De La Salle Collegiate) hit Peczynski home with a single down the right field line, while Finn crossed home plate on a wild pitch.
The Scots added to their lead the top of the fourth inning when Roeske hit an RBI single to score Peczynski, who had opened the inning with a single down the right field line. Alma continued their offensive surge with a run in the top of the fifth when Walters scored on a RBI single by San Miguel. The Scots then made it 7-0 in the top of the sixth when Goffee hit an RBI double to score junior Dalvin Ramos (Chicago, Ill./North Grand/Morton College), while Walters hit a single down the right field line to score Goffee.
Peczynski completed the scoring in the top of the seventh with a two-run homer to left field.
